It is a strong app, arguably the most polished in its category but the subscription simply doesn’t justify itself, especially when it costs more than Google Health Premium. At that price point, choosing Bevel over Google Health makes little sense. Google Health may be going through a rough patch right now, but those issues will get ironed out, and Google’s AI will always outclass anything a third‑party developer can build.

Where Bevel makes more sense is for Apple Watch users, because Apple Health and Apple Fitness lack a lot of basic functionality. But even there, the value proposition is shaky: the App Store is full of similar apps that cost far less.

So it comes with a similar dilemma to Whoop subscription. If you have disposable income and enjoy the experience, fine, it won’t hurt. But for an average user, you can get essentially the same functionality from cheaper apps or even free ones.
